Junior “Earl” Small

PRINCETON — Earl Small, 86, of Fair Grounds Road slipped quietly from this earthly world Friday, October 23, 2009 at Princeton Community Hospital.

Born in Bellwood, WVa. on November 7, 1922 to the late Robert and Grace Small, Earl was a veteran of World War II and worked as an electrical foreman for Semet-Salvey, Allied Chemical and A T Massey for 43 years having retired in 1984. He had lived in Mullens, W.Va. for many years where he helped organize the Boy Scouts of America where he served as leader. He also ran an appliance repair shop. He was a resident of Havaco, W.Va. for 28 years where he retired from Shannon-Pocahontas mines in Caples. He also organized McDowell County Rescure Squad, where he served as Captain of the Squad for several years. Earl had been a resident of Princeton since 1991.
